A parcel forwarding service such as Forward2me is another excellent way to shop online for clothes. These services provide you with the UK shipping adress and can collect your orders from various websites and deliver them to you in a single package. This is a great option for those who live abroad or want to avoid the shipping restrictions on a lot of UK-based sites.

If you're looking to buy clothes from the UK but don't live in the UK, A Christmas Story Merchandise - This Webpage - you can use an online service like Jetkrate. This will provide you with a unique UK address which you can use to shop with every retailer. The company will then keep your purchases locally until they are ready to be delivered to you. This service is ideal for people who are moving into the UK or don't know anyone from the country.
